英文摘要 | The morphology, phase composition, particle size distribution, thermal stability and microhardness of the gas atomized Al86Ni6Y4.5Co2La1.5 amorphous alloy powder were investigated by scanning electron microscope (SEM), X-ray diffractometry, X-ray Photoelectron Spectroscopy (XPS), particle size analysis, differential scanning calorimetry (DSC), and hardness tester, respectively. The result show that most of the Al86Ni6Y4.5Co2La1.5 amorphous alloy powder is below 45 mu m (about 80%), and the powder is consisted of amorphous matrix and nano-crystallization phase. Its crystallization process is amorphous -> amorphous'+fcc-Al -> fcc-Al+AlNiY+Al2Y There exists a layer of Al2O3 oxidation with 180.81 nm in width. The hardness of the powder is beyond 3000 MPa. |
